Blue poppy seeds: export prices under pressure

December 18, 2019 at 2:22 PM , Der AUDITOR
Play report as audio

ANKARA/CHRUDIM. Before the end of the year, blue poppy seed prices in Turkey are currently under pressure. The weakening TRY is accelerating this development.

Turkish blue poppy seeds from USD 3.45 per kg

After the prices for Czech blue poppy seeds have constantly declined in recent weeks, the competitor from Turkey is now going along. The weak TRY additionally forwards the price decline. Traders currently quote price indications of USD 3.45-3.50 per kg CFR Hamburg. In the Czech Republic, the price indications are about EUR 2.80 per kg FCA.
